Module Awso_mpa.EndpointsSource

Sourcetype ('i, 'o, 'e) t =
  1. | CancelSession : (Values.CancelSessionRequest.t, Values.CancelSessionResponse.t, Values.CancelSessionResponse.error) t
  2. | CreateApprovalTeam : (Values.CreateApprovalTeamRequest.t, Values.CreateApprovalTeamResponse.t, Values.CreateApprovalTeamResponse.error) t
  3. | CreateIdentitySource : (Values.CreateIdentitySourceRequest.t, Values.CreateIdentitySourceResponse.t, Values.CreateIdentitySourceResponse.error) t
  4. | DeleteIdentitySource : (Values.DeleteIdentitySourceRequest.t, unit, unit) t
  5. | DeleteInactiveApprovalTeamVersion : (Values.DeleteInactiveApprovalTeamVersionRequest.t, Values.DeleteInactiveApprovalTeamVersionResponse.t, Values.DeleteInactiveApprovalTeamVersionResponse.error) t
  6. | GetApprovalTeam : (Values.GetApprovalTeamRequest.t, Values.GetApprovalTeamResponse.t, Values.GetApprovalTeamResponse.error) t
  7. | GetIdentitySource : (Values.GetIdentitySourceRequest.t, Values.GetIdentitySourceResponse.t, Values.GetIdentitySourceResponse.error) t
  8. | GetPolicyVersion : (Values.GetPolicyVersionRequest.t, Values.GetPolicyVersionResponse.t, Values.GetPolicyVersionResponse.error) t
  9. | GetResourcePolicy : (Values.GetResourcePolicyRequest.t, Values.GetResourcePolicyResponse.t, Values.GetResourcePolicyResponse.error) t
  10. | GetSession : (Values.GetSessionRequest.t, Values.GetSessionResponse.t, Values.GetSessionResponse.error) t
  11. | ListApprovalTeams : (Values.ListApprovalTeamsRequest.t, Values.ListApprovalTeamsResponse.t, Values.ListApprovalTeamsResponse.error) t
  12. | ListIdentitySources : (Values.ListIdentitySourcesRequest.t, Values.ListIdentitySourcesResponse.t, Values.ListIdentitySourcesResponse.error) t
  13. | ListPolicies : (Values.ListPoliciesRequest.t, Values.ListPoliciesResponse.t, Values.ListPoliciesResponse.error) t
  14. | ListPolicyVersions : (Values.ListPolicyVersionsRequest.t, Values.ListPolicyVersionsResponse.t, Values.ListPolicyVersionsResponse.error) t
  15. | ListResourcePolicies : (Values.ListResourcePoliciesRequest.t, Values.ListResourcePoliciesResponse.t, Values.ListResourcePoliciesResponse.error) t
  16. | ListSessions : (Values.ListSessionsRequest.t, Values.ListSessionsResponse.t, Values.ListSessionsResponse.error) t
  17. | ListTagsForResource : (Values.ListTagsForResourceRequest.t, Values.ListTagsForResourceResponse.t, Values.ListTagsForResourceResponse.error) t
  18. | StartActiveApprovalTeamDeletion : (Values.StartActiveApprovalTeamDeletionRequest.t, Values.StartActiveApprovalTeamDeletionResponse.t, Values.StartActiveApprovalTeamDeletionResponse.error) t
  19. | StartApprovalTeamBaseline : (Values.StartApprovalTeamBaselineRequest.t, Values.StartApprovalTeamBaselineResponse.t, Values.StartApprovalTeamBaselineResponse.error) t
  20. | TagResource : (Values.TagResourceRequest.t, Values.TagResourceResponse.t, Values.TagResourceResponse.error) t
  21. | UntagResource : (Values.UntagResourceRequest.t, Values.UntagResourceResponse.t, Values.UntagResourceResponse.error) t
  22. | UpdateApprovalTeam : (Values.UpdateApprovalTeamRequest.t, Values.UpdateApprovalTeamResponse.t, Values.UpdateApprovalTeamResponse.error) t
Sourceval method_of_endpoint : 'i 'o 'e. ('i, 'o, 'e) t -> [> `DELETE | `GET | `PATCH | `POST | `PUT ]
Sourceval uri_of_endpoint : 'i 'o 'e. ('i, 'o, 'e) t -> 'i -> Uri.t
Sourceval to_request : ('i, 'o, 'e) t -> 'i -> Awso.Http.Request.t
Sourceval of_response : ('i, 'o, 'e) t -> Awso.Http.Response.t -> ('o, 'e) result